Understanding the Mechanics of the Game
At its heart, the game features a rising curve, representing the increasing multiplier. The longer the airplane stays airborne, the higher the multiplier climbs. The objective for the player is to cash out at the optimal time, securing their initial bet multiplied by the current multiplier. The challenge lies in the inherent unpredictability; the airplane can ‘fly away’ at any moment, resulting in a loss of the initial bet. A critical component often used by players is the ‘auto cash-out’ feature, where a predetermined multiplier is set, and the game automatically cashes out when that multiplier is reached. This feature helps mitigate risk and remove some pressure, but it also means potentially missing out on larger multipliers.

Setting Stop-Loss and Take-Profit Limits
Setting predefined stop-loss and take-profit limits is a fundamental principle of responsible gambling. A stop-loss limit defines the maximum amount of money you are willing to lose within a given timeframe. Once this limit is reached, you should stop playing, regardless of whether you believe you can recover your losses. A take-profit limit, on the other hand, defines the amount of money you are aiming to win. Once you reach this target, it’s advisable to cash out and enjoy your profits. These limits help prevent emotional decision-making and ensure that you are playing within your financial means. It’s a vital element of responsible gameplay that can significantly reduce the risk of substantial losses.
